The location

Nestled in the picturesque hamlet of Downgate, surrounded by the natural beauty of Bodmin Moor, this residence enjoys an idyllic rural setting. The nearby village of Upton Cross offers essential amenities, including an eco primary school, Post Office, Parish Church, village hall, public house, and the renowned Sterts Arts Centre.

A mere 7 miles away, the thriving market town of Liskeard provides convenient access to Cornwall's South Coast with sandy beaches. Liskeard itself boasts a range of facilities, including a retail park, supermarkets, a leisure centre, and excellent educational options. The town is well-connected via a mainline railway station and easy access to the A38 and A30, providing direct routes to Exeter and throughout Cornwall.
